Abstract

Social media has become an important hospitality-industry tool for influencing hotel selection. Travelers use platforms such as Facebook, Instagram, and TikTok to obtain hotel information, view visual content, and read guest reviews before booking. This study examined how social media shaped guests’ hotel preferences at AI Hotel North Caloocan and provided a basis for improving the hotel’s marketing strategy. The study used a quantitative descriptive-comparative research design. A survey questionnaire was distributed to thirty (30) guests who had visited or reserved at AI Hotel North Caloocan and were familiar with its social media platforms. The questionnaire covered respondent characteristics and the influence of social media as a source of hotel information, visual content, online reviews and ratings, and brand image and reputation. Data were analyzed using frequency distribution, weighted mean, and z-test. Most respondents were 21–28 years of age, and Facebook was the most commonly used social media platform. Respondents strongly agreed that social media provided important hotel information and influenced hotel selection. Visual content, guest reviews, and promotional posts were among the factors that encouraged respondents to consider or book a hotel. The findings suggested that social media contributed to guests’ hotel preferences. The study recommended that hotels strengthen their online presence by posting engaging visual content, responding to guest feedback, and maintaining active communication with prospective guests. Improved social media marketing may support customer acquisition and competitiveness.
